46. Pelle Eklund

46. Pelle Eklund
From Stockholm, Sweden, Pelle Eklund played all but five of his NHL Games with the Philadelphia Flyers where he scored 452 Points over 589 Games for a decent .77 Point per Game Average.  Eklund was a very clean player who only 107 Penalty Minutes as a Flyer and he had three seasons where he received votes for the Lady Byng.  His best run with Philadelphia was in the 1987 playoffs where he scored 27 Points in 26 Games.

The Bullet Points

  • Position: Center
  • Acquired: Selected in the 8th Round, 161st Overall in the NHL Draft 6/8/83.
  • Departed: Traded to the Dallas Stars for Dallas’ 1994 8th Round Pick (which would be Raymond Giroux) 3/21/94.
  • Games Played: 589
  • Notable Statistics: 118 Goals
    334 Assists
    452 Points
    107 PIM
    .77 PPG
    +12 Plus/Minus
    27.3 Point Shares

    57 Playoff Games
    10 Goals
    33 Assists
    43 Points
    4 PIM
    .75 PPG
    +12 Plus/Minus
  • Major Accolades and Awards: None.
